Sound travels at 343 meters per second. You measured 3 seconds for sound travel from place A to place B. What is the distance between A and B? meters

Answer: 1029 meters

Explanation:

Given: The speed of sound = 343 meters per second

The time taken by sound to travel distance from A to B = 3 seconds

We know that the formula to calculate distance is given by :-


\text{Distance= Speed *Time}

Then , the distance between A and B is given by :-


\text{Distance= }343*3=1029\text{ meters}

Hence, the distance between A and B is 1029 meters.
